The Human Cognitive Bandwidth Challenge

At the heart of the governance problem is the concept of human cognitive bandwidth. This term refers to the limited capacity of individuals to process information, make decisions, and respond to the complexities of societal systems. As issues become more intricate—ranging from economic fluctuations to environmental crises—individuals and leaders alike may find themselves overwhelmed. The resulting cognitive overload can lead to reliance on shortcuts, or cognitive biases, which can skew decision-making processes and exacerbate existing problems.

For instance, when faced with a flood of data and potential courses of action, decision-makers may default to familiar patterns or heuristics that don’t necessarily align with the complexities at hand. This reliance on cognitive shortcuts can result in ineffective policies and missed opportunities for innovation.

The Role of Automation

In response to the challenges posed by cognitive bandwidth limitations, many governments and organizations have turned to automation. Systems designed to streamline decision-making processes can alleviate some burdens on human cognition. However, this reliance on automated systems carries its own risks. If these systems are not designed thoughtfully, they may perpetuate existing biases or fail to adapt to the nuances of complex situations.

Furthermore, the interplay between human decision-making and automated systems raises questions about accountability. As machines take on more decision-making responsibilities, who remains accountable for the outcomes? This dilemma underscores the need for a careful balance between human oversight and automated processes.

The Rise of Large Language Models

Enter large language models (LLMs), which have the potential to transform our interactions with machines and each other. These advanced AI systems are capable of processing vast amounts of information and generating human-like text, which can be harnessed in various ways, from enhancing communication to automating routine tasks. As LLMs continue to evolve, they may serve as powerful tools for navigating the complexities of governance.

For example, LLMs can assist in data analysis, helping decision-makers extract meaningful insights from large datasets. They can also improve transparency by generating summaries of complex policy documents, making information more accessible to the public. Moreover, LLMs can facilitate real-time communication, allowing citizens to engage with their governments more effectively.
